There are 10 tables associated with this guidance note, listed in the table below, which shows:

  • Table ID - the name assigned to the table of factors in the Consolidated Factor Workbook.
  • Alternative table ref. - this shows the name assigned to the tables of factors in our guidance notes prior to the introduction of the Consolidated Factor Workbook and may still be referred to in the explanations of the formulae within this guidance.
  • Factor Type, Section, Description, Gender - give information about the tables of factors so that you can verify that the appropriate table is being used for the circumstances of the case
The required factors can be found by locating the correct table from the Consolidated Factor Workbook, which can be found by selecting the Consolidated Factor Workbook tab in the navigation bar above or use the Download current Consolidated Factor Workbook button on the right of the scheme homepage.
